Digging with a Skid Steer: Tips and Techniques

A skid steer, informally called as a skid steer loader, is a handy, movable, and spatially small-scale machinery equipment widely employed in the construction, landscape, and agricultural sectors.

The one-of-a-kind design of the skid steer loader sets it apart with a rigid frame and a pair of lift arms that can be complemented with various add-ons, making it meet the demands of numerous tasks.

The term “skid steer” refers to the skid steer loader’s turning ability by skimming its wheels, a technical specification that practically ensures easy maneuverability through confined areas.

This feature turns out to be super-practical for the task, e.g., in the city where there is often not enough space. Skid steer operation is simplified by dual hand controls that regulate the movement of the vehicle and its accessories.

The battle is twofold here as the operator has to master them in order to have full control of the machine while also needing some time to get used to it first. Familiarizing oneself with the basics of the skid steer loader, its hydraulic system, weight distribution, and center of gravity, is a requirement for the efficient performance of any unit.

Choosing the Right Attachments for Digging

It’s key to maximize the efficiency and productivity of a skid steer by having the right accessories that are perfect for digging tasks. Perforating is the most common method for digging and a bucket is also one of the common attachments in digging which comes in different sizes and designs for handling different types of the soil and other requisitions of the project.

To clarify this, the General Purpose bucket can be effective in scooping loose materials like sand, gravel, etc, while the tooth buckets are used to break down the compacted materials or hard soils.

The choice of bucket size should be determined by the skid-steer that is to lift the material and the accurate requirements of the task. We can also avail the backhoe loader for the trenching and excavation specific process that also has the as a reach and digging and it enhances operator efficiency.

This instrument is perfect for people who are required to work at high precision and speed in the trenching and digging processes. For example a drill can be used to make the required holes for the trees to be planted or the fence posts by running augers through the ground.

The right pick of the skid steer attachment will need to think about a few factors including the skid steer model compatibility the attachment ease of the installation process and the specific project conditions.

Preparing the Work Area for Digging

In order to start a skid steer digging task, we have to make sure the preparation of the work area is made. The process is initiated by a full assessment whereby the entire site is scrutinized and all potential dangers are outlined–like underground utilities and big rocks or roots which might be a hindrance to the project.

The use of a utility locator can make sure that no underground lines are destroyed during the excavation. Also, the marking of the area where the digging will take place can bring absolute surety as well as avoiding structures and landscapes getting destroyed due to anyone’s carelessness. After the site has been surveyed and marked, the clearing of the area of debris and obstacles is an absolute necessity.

This might include removing vegetation, rocks, or other materials which might cause the skid steer’s movement to get obstructed or interfere with the excavation. The next step is to flatten the ground and make it more solid.

A more leveled surface will not only make the operation easier but also will be safer for the operator and any other person present. Moreover, installing a barrier around the work area would also help minimize the danger of unauthorized entry, thus, decreasing the likelihood of a hazard occurring during the task.

Operating the Skid Steer Safely and Efficiently

Before starting the machine, the primary step is for equipment operators to diligently check for oil, tire air pressure, and the total system. The presence of all safety measures such as seat belts and rollover protection systems is crucial in order to maintain a low level of harm.

Aside from that, operatos should make sure to become aware of the machinery operation principles and features on their skid steer model in order to gain control over it and handle it effectively. It is the human factor of awareness that is of the greatest significance while in motion.

They should constantly look around them for the most hazardous events that can occur such as pedestrians, all different kinds of machinery or uneven pathways.

It is best to stay away from precipices and hills. This is the best way to prevent tipping over or loss of control over the machine respectively.

In addition, smooth actions should be taken when moving the skid steer to avoid abrupt jerks that might end in a collision or with the equipment getting damaged. By giving respect to safety and efficiency in operations, operators can accomplish higher productivity with less risk.

Techniques for Digging with a Skid Steer

It is known that using the skid steer for digging tasks can lead to a more efficient and accurate performance on construction sites. Basically, the technique centers around bucket placement to get an adequate hole and to remove as much material as possible.

Indeed, moving the selected bucket a little downwards into the ground, and at the same time, pivoting it forward will allow the bucket to obtain a more efficient behavior due to the compacted earth breaking up.

After the load is collected, lifting it gently away is the key to less spillage at the site. Another important technique is to follow a structured method in a process of digging.

Lifters should be in rows or sections rather than take the whole part at a time. This way, they can manage better the depth and the equipment is operated so that more material is removed through the whole area.

Furthermore, drivers must consider their speed of digging; quickness may cause them to be off target and thus lead to high risks of accidents and to damages to the equipment as well as the surrounding zones. The application of these techniques will result in better productivity and quality of underground construction works.

Dealing with Challenging Soil Conditions

 

Choosing the Right Attachments

When the ground is hard, the use of specialized tools and attachments can be the best solution for the job. Example is the situation where a toothed-digging bucket is more effective in the breaking of hard layers in the soil rather than a plain one. The preferred gear, when used by the workers, will help them to have less probability of failure in their quest.

Adapting to Soil Conditions

Having chosen the right attachment, operators must also adjust their approach to the specific soil conditions they are working in. For instance, when working in clay-heavy areas, it might be advantageous to dig in smaller increments rather than trying to remove large volumes at once.

As a result, better control over material removal is achieved, while the hydraulic system of the skid steer is relieved of the reduction of the loads on it.

Monitoring Soil Moisture

Another instance for the prompt is when the operators also should remain cautious and monitor the soil moisture levels. Excessive water can cause tires to slip on road or while on site thus, increasing the chances of accidents which are also very costly as they lead to equipment damage. Besides, paying attention to these factors, operators can ensure the success of the safest and most reliable excavations.

Troubleshooting Common Digging Issues with a Skid Steer

Even if everything is taken care of and everything is done properly, drivers can still encounter common problems while using a skid steer. One of the frequent aspects is the digging depth issue because of the bucket’s wrong placing or not enough weight in the front of the machine.

Operators should address the cause of this problem by making sure they have chosen the right bucket type that is suitable for the type of the soil and adjust their digging method accordingly.

Another common problem is the material spilling during transport. The main reason for this is that the bucket is raised too high by the operators or the bucket is not properly tilted in the transfer process.

To alleviate this situation, the drivers should take such precautions as creating a lower center of gravity to carry the material under the loads while they are driving.

Also, the movement speed can be adjusted to help restrict the material from pilling by giving space for better movements in the rough terrain. Operators, with troubleshooting strategies that are effective, can significantly improve their performance by knowing and dealing with the common problems which may arise while using a skid steer for digging jobs at the construction site.
